Can't you just jack one side of car up really high then lower it down onto a couple of oil barrels or similar (I've used ex F1 wheels before with the kit car) obviously you need to support it in a few directions, chock etc so if one support fails or the car slips it gets caught by something else but it does give access for short periods of time.
The other one I've used for access is to jack the whole car up onto high chocks like old F1 wheels to give yourself 2-3ft of clearance under
